沙苑子黄酮对衰老模型小鼠的自由基代谢及免疫力的影响  被引量:8

Study on Anti-aging Effects of Flavonoids of Astragali Complanali on Subacute Aging Mice Induced by D-galactose

摘  要:目的探讨沙苑子黄酮(FAC)对D-半乳糖(D-gal)致衰老模型小鼠的延缓衰老作用及其机制。方法选择ICR小鼠60只,将其随机分为6组:正常对照组(NG组)、模型对照组(MG组)、阳性药对照组(VE组,25mg·kg-1.d-1)、FAC高剂量组(FAC-H组,200mg·kg-1.d-1)、FAC中剂量组(FAC-M组,100mg.kg-1.d-1)及FAC低剂量组(FAC-L组,50mg·kg-1.d-1),各10只。除NG组外,其余5组使用D-gal按120mg·kg-1.d-1于小鼠背部皮下注射,连续30d,造成亚急性衰老模型。从造模的第21天开始,VE组小鼠灌服25mg.kg-1.d-1维生素,MG组小鼠灌服等体积0.9%氯化钠注射液,FAC-H、FAC-M、FAC-L组小鼠分别灌服相应浓度的FAC,连续10d。末次给药后30min从眼眶取血,按照测试盒要求检测并比较6组小鼠的自由基代谢〔超氧化物歧化酶(SOD)活性及丙二醛(MDA)、一氧化氮(NO)水平〕及免疫力指标〔胸腺指数(SI)、脾脏指数(TI)、碳廓清指数(K)及淋巴细胞转化率(用570nm测得OD值A代替)〕。本实验重复进行3次,所得数据取平均值。结果(1)与NG组比较,MG组小鼠血清SOD活性降低,MDA、NO水平升高,差异均有统计学意义(P<0.01)。FAC-H组、FAC-M组、FAC-L组小鼠血清SOD活性较MG组显著提高,血清MDA、NO水平较MG组显著下降,差异均有统计学意义(P<0.01)。(2)MG组小鼠的TI、SI、K、A与NG组比较,差异均有统计学意义(P<0.01)。FAC-H、FAC-M、FAC-L组小鼠TI、SI、K、A与MG组比较,差异有统计学意义(P<0.05);K、A与VE组比较,差异亦有统计学意义(P<0.05)。结论FAC具有抗衰老作用,能显著提高衰老小鼠血中SOD活性,降低MDA和NO水平,增加衰老模型鼠的免疫器官湿重指数,提高巨噬细胞吞噬功能及淋巴细胞转化率。其作用可能与增强非特异性免疫功能有关。Objective To study the effects of flavonoids of astragali complanalli (FAC) in sub - acute aging mice caused by D - galactose. Methods Sixty ICR mice were randomly divided into groups normal control ( NG group) , model con- trol (MGgroup), VitaminE (VEgroup, 25 mg- kg-~ ~ d-l), FAChigh-dose (FAC-Hgroup, 200mg. kg-~ ~ d-l), FACmedium-dose (FAC-Mgroup, 100mg'kg-~ "d-~) and FAC low - dose (FAC-Lgroup, 50mg·kg-1·d-1), 10 in each. Sub - acute aging mice models were established by injection of D - gal ( 120 mg·kg-1·d-1, 30 d) in all groups ex- cept NG group. From days 21 of establishment, groups FAC - H, FAC - M, FAC - L were fed with corresponding concentra- tions of FAC, 10 d. Blood was taken from the eyes 30 min after the last administration, and superoxide dismutase (SOD) activi- ty, malondialdehyde (MDA), nitric oside (NO), and such indicators of immunity as spleen index (SI), thymus index (TI), carbon clearance index (K) and lymphocyte transformation rate ( expressed by A of OD value measured by 570nm). This experi- ment repeated 3 times, the data averaged. Results When compared with NG group, serum SOD activity decreased, MDA, NO increased in MG group, the difference was significant (P 〈0. 01 ). SOD activity was significantly higher, MDA, NO lower in groups FAC - H, FAC - M, FAC - L than in group MG ( P 〈0. 01 ). There was significant difference in TI, SI, K, A be- tween groups MG and NG (P 〈 0. O1 ), and between groups FAC - H, FAC - M, FAC - L and group MG (P 〈 0.05), and in K, A between groups FAC - H, FAC - M, FAC - L and group VE ( P 〈 0.05 ). Conclusion FAC, having anti - aging effects, can significantly increase serum SOD activity, lower MDA and NO, improve immune organ wet weight index and macro- phage phagocytosis and lymphocyte transformation rate. It may be related to the enhancement of non - specific immune function.
